Factores de riesgo
- Break-even variability: 11–57 months suggests revenue swings can significantly delay profitability
- High dependence on topline volume: monthly revenue range ($17,640–$30,240) implies margin risk if foot traffic underperforms
- Competitive concentration risk: with 0 nearby competitors flagged, demand uncertainty could be mistaken for opportunity
- Local purchasing power constraint: GDP/capita of $6,150 may cap spend per customer and limit upsell pricing
Plan de ejecución
- Validate local demand in Huehuetenango with 2–3 weeks of foot-traffic and night-time sales tests before full rollout
- Build a bar offer tailored to local price sensitivity (value bundles, drink promotions, and weekday vs. weekend menus)
- Secure reliable supply for key SKUs (beer, spirits, mixers) and lock favorable pricing to protect profit when revenue is lower-end
- Launch with retention drivers: loyalty punches, event nights (music/sports), and neighborhood partnerships (shops, services)
- Track daily KPIs (cover count, avg ticket, gross margin, labor cost) and adjust staffing and hours to close toward the 11-month break-even target
- Invest in high-visibility signage and street-level accessibility to maximize walk-ins and reduce customer acquisition cost
